At Hypertherm Associates , our products help customers around the world cut metal more efficiently, safely, and precisely. As a Sustaining Engineering Co-op, you will play an active role in improving released products while gaining hands‑on experience working alongside experienced engineers and cross-functional teams.
Location: Hanover, NH
This position offers the opportunity to apply classroom knowledge to real-world engineering challenges involving product performance, manufacturing support, component obsolescence, cost reduction, and regulatory compliance. You will contribute to meaningful projects that directly impact our plasma and waterjet cutting systems and the customers who rely on them every day.
As part of the Central Engineering team, you will support the ongoing success of released products throughout their lifecycle. Working under the guidance of experienced engineers, you will:
From day one, you will have the opportunity to own meaningful engineering work. Each co‑op is expected to lead a project or project assignment, apply engineering problem‑solving skills to deliver results, and present project outcomes and recommendations to engineering leadership and cross‑functional stakeholders. You will receive mentorship from experienced engineers while gaining exposure to real‑world engineering challenges that directly impact our products and customers.
